From Lawyer to Leader: The Road to the General Counsel Seat
In collaboration with
This program is currently under development and planned for a late August 2026 launch.
The program provides a structured pathway for junior and mid-level law firm and in-house attorneys seeking to advance into senior level in-house positions. During the 12 weeks, participants explore the full scope of in-house counsel’s responsibilities and skillsets ranging from strategic business advising and corporate governance, to team building and in-house management skills, to financial acumen, ethics and compliance, and crisis management.
Instruction is delivered through a hybrid format of live synchronous sessions (60-90 minutes per week) and asynchronous learning activities (articles, case studies, and discussions). The synchronous sessions foster meaningful networking while allowing participants to actively engage with course concepts in real time.
The program features a diverse faculty of experienced General Counsel, CPAs, and corporate executives from industries such as healthcare, technology, entertainment, consumer goods, mortgages, and finance. These experts have experience with both public and private companies, and they bring decades of leadership experience from companies like loanDepot, ASICS, Deloitte, CBRE, and Cottage Health, ensuring that the program’s content is practical, relevant, and rooted in real-world application.
Who Should Enroll
The program is designed for:
- Junior and mid-level law firm attorneys seeking to move into in-house legal positions
- Current in-house counsel aspiring to expand their strategic, managerial, and business capabilities
- Aspiring General Counsels preparing to transition into senior level corporate roles
- Experienced legal professionals seeking a deeper understanding of risk management, compliance, financial acumen and corporate governance

Eligibility and Requirements
Participants should have at least five years of post-bar experience and be licensed to practice law (bar licensure in any U.S. jurisdiction is sufficient).
A participant in the program is awarded a specialization certificate upon the successful completion of one course for 3 CEU. As CEU courses are non-credit offerings designated under the 800 series and will not offer Letter or Pass/No Pass grade options. A grade of “CE” (Continuing Education) will be issued upon satisfactory completion of all course requirements and will appear on the student’s record as confirmation of successful participation.
Digital certificates will be issued to students who successfully complete the course within three weeks of the course end date. Certificates will be issued with the name on file and to the email on file.
